Caillat's new album will be called 'All of You,' but 'I Do' is getting the official single treatment today with it's release to radio. The upbeat, and happy single was written by Caillat and Toby Gad and produced by Greg Wells, and sees a return to form for the singer-songwriter, who won a Grammy for her 2008 duet with Jason Mraz, 'Lucky.' Caillat said 'I Do' is about marriage, but is "supposed to be sort of a joke and is hard to explain."
Along with 'I Do,' Colbie Caillat's new album will also feature special guests, including a track with hip-hop artist Common and a rumored collaboration with Lady Antebellum. 'All of You' hits store shelves May 3.
